The Buffalo & Erie County Greenway Committee
includes a representative from the City of Buffalo, Erie County,
Buffalo Olmsted Parks Conservancy and the New York Power Authority.
The Buffalo & Erie County Greenway Committee
receives funds from NYPA, as part of a settlement agreement related
to the new 50-year license received by NYPA for the Niagara
project. During the term of the new license, the Buffalo & Erie
County Standing Committee will receive $2 million a year for a total
of $100 million for the development of the Niagara River Greenway in
their region.
